Chris McChesney
Author of The 4 Disciplines of Execution
Chris McChesney is a Wall Street Journal #1 national bestselling author of The 4 Disciplines of Execution and is the Global Practice Leader of Execution for Franklin Covey. For more than 20 years he has led FranklinCovey’s ongoing design and development of these principles, as well as the consulting organization that has achieved extraordinary growth in many countries around the globe and impacted thousands of organizations.
Chris’s career with FranklinCovey began by working directly with Dr. Stephen R. Covey, and has continued over two decades to include roles as a consultant, managing director, and general manager within the organization. Chris launched the first 4 Disciplines of Execution® practice in the southeast region of FranklinCovey, USA, and has seen it expand around the globe. Throughout this period of significant growth and expansion, Chris has maintained a single focus: to help organizations get results through improved execution.
Known for his engaging message, Chris has become a highly sought-after speaker, consultant, and advisor on strategy execution, regularly delivering keynote speeches and executive presentations to some of the world’s largest leadership conferences, including the Global Leadership Summit and World Business Forum.
Session Title:
Turning Strategy into Action: How to Execute and Achieve Business Goals in an Ever-Changing World
Do you remember the last major initiative you watched die in your organization? Did it go down with a loud crash? Or was it slowly and quietly suffocated by other competing priorities? By the time it finally disappeared, it's likely no one even noticed. What happened? The whirlwind of urgent activity required to keep YOUR ORGANIZATION running day-to-day devoured all the time and energy you needed to invest in executing your strategy.
The 4DX framework helps organizations achieve their most important goals: Digital and AI Transformation Implementations, changes in organizational IT Infrastructure and systems, etc. 4DX is not theory, but a proven set of principles and practices that have been tested and refined by hundreds of organizations and 126,000+ teams over many years. When a company or an individual adheres to these disciplines, they achieve superb results –– regardless of the goal. 4DX represents a new way of thinking and working that are essential to thriving in today's competitive climate.

Focus on the Wildly Important:
Exceptional execution starts with narrowing the focus— clearly identifying what must be done, or nothing else you achieve really matters much.
-
Act on the Lead Measures:
Twenty percent of activities produce eighty percent of results. The highest predictors of goal achievement are the 80/20 activities that are identified and codified into individual actions and tracked fanatically.
-
Keep a Compelling Scoreboard:
People and teams play differently when they are keeping score, and the right kind of scoreboards motivate the players to win. -
Create a Cadence of Accountability:
Great performers thrive in a culture of accountability that is frequent, positive, and self-directed. Each team engages in a simple weekly process that highlights successes, analyzes failures, and course-corrects as necessary, creating the ultimate performance-management system.
